Troubles Victims' Relatives To Meet UN Today, Over Plans To End Prosecutions.

Image: UN Logo

The UK government wants to ban all Troubles-related prosecutions.

Relatives of Troubles victims are set to speak to the UN Human Rights Council later today.

It's part of an attempt to stop a UK government proposal to ban all Troubles-related prosecutions.

It means no ex-soldiers or paramilitaries would be able to be convicted for historical killings in Northern Ireland.
